Boonooroo Plains QLD — Suburb Profile

Population, median income, rent prices, housing costs and demographics for Boonooroo Plains, Queensland. ABS Census 2021.

The population of Boonooroo Plains QLD is 6 according to the 2021 Census. The median personal income in Boonooroo Plains is $812 per week ($42,224 per year). Boonooroo Plains has a median age of 61 years, older than the national median of 38. Boonooroo Plains has a population density of 0.1 people per km².

The most common religion is Uniting Church (100% of residents).
